I really got a heck of a deal on this thing, with the price I paid for the quad and the parts to fix it, I am at about $700.00. Mechanically,it's great for an 04 model and I really enjoy riding it,even being stock. I do plan on some upgrades at some point,you can tell it's detuned pretty good.

Mickey Dunlap
10-11-2014, 07:37 PM
I really got a heck of a deal on this thing, with the price I paid for the quad and the parts to fix it, I am at about $700.00. Mechanically,it's great for an 04 model and I really enjoy riding it,even being stock. I do plan on some upgrades at some point,you can tell it's detuned pretty good.

Yes the respond real good to mods. Put a Muzzys super pro pipe on it and go my std. bore with stage 2 cams and you will go from 32hp to over 60rwhp. Super reliable and still runs on pump gas. http://www.fourstroketech.net/

i think im almost convinced on doing a 730 kit in my kfx 700 also

op, these kfx's are a blast. i traded a banshee for one. never looked back. they seem slow off the line, but like mickey said, they respond well to mods. i have a 12 hole mod, jet kit, and muzzy super pro. it seemed to wake it up alot. the super pro sounds like pure heaven. like a supercharged monster truck. its loud, but not obnoxious loud
